Output 0e8863520392cc6c5404e1b14418588a0aa653e063e03e424a43c90b150a3915:0

value
99501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bafa92359cce23727c064f9ae88501b2dfc2870 OP_EQUAL
address
3Cy1UFvAZ5i3q7tXrzDfWmLQfNtVjuoE7A
transaction
0e8863520392cc6c5404e1b14418588a0aa653e063e03e424a43c90b150a3915
spent
true